diff options
Diffstat (limited to 'bitbake/bin')
| -rwxr-xr-x | bitbake/bin/bitbake-getvar |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/bitbake/bin/bitbake-getvar b/bitbake/bin/bitbake-getvar index 1719824d95..378fb13572 100755 --- a/bitbake/bin/bitbake-getvar +++ b/bitbake/bin/bitbake-getvar | |||
| @@ -10,6 +10,7 @@ import io | |||
| 10 | import os | 10 | import os |
| 11 | import sys | 11 | import sys |
| 12 | import warnings | 12 | import warnings |
| 13 | import logging | ||
| 13 | warnings.simplefilter("default") | 14 | warnings.simplefilter("default") |
| 14 | 15 | ||
| 15 | bindir = os.path.dirname(__file__) | 16 | bindir = os.path.dirname(__file__) |
| @@ -38,6 +39,10 @@ if __name__ == "__main__": | |||
| 38 | sys.exit("--flag only makes sense with --value") | 39 | sys.exit("--flag only makes sense with --value") |
| 39 | 40 | ||
| 40 | quiet = args.quiet or args.value | 41 | quiet = args.quiet or args.value |
| 42 | if quiet: | ||
| 43 | logger = logging.getLogger("BitBake") | ||
| 44 | logger.setLevel(logging.WARNING) | ||
| 45 | |||
| 41 | with bb.tinfoil.Tinfoil(tracking=True, setup_logging=not quiet) as tinfoil: | 46 | with bb.tinfoil.Tinfoil(tracking=True, setup_logging=not quiet) as tinfoil: |
| 42 | if args.recipe: | 47 | if args.recipe: |
| 43 | tinfoil.prepare(quiet=3 if quiet else 2) | 48 | tinfoil.prepare(quiet=3 if quiet else 2) |
